This Pakistani wrestler begins preparing for 2024 Paris Olympics

By   - 24/04/2020

Pakistan wrestler Inayatullah has said he is aiming for a medal at the 2024 Paris Olympics. “Yes, the target is achievable. I can win a medal in 2024 Olympics if the government starts supporting me from this year,” Inayat told Pakistan daily The News.

Inayat, 19, grabbed bronze in the 2018 Youth Olympics after defeating US wrestler Carson Taylor Manville 3-1 in the 65kg in Buenos Aires. The Pakistan government awarded the young wrestler the prize money of Rs five million for the achievement.

“I know the standard around the world and I believe in myself and with god’s grace make Pakistan proud,” Inayat said. Inayat’s father Zahid Khan remained national champion for over a decade besides claiming medals in the international circuit.

Inayat was roped in by WAPDA after he won gold in the 2012 National Under-14 event for a minor stipend of Rs 5000. Now he is a permanent employee of the department and is in Grade-16.

Currently, he is nursing a knee injury and has been advised by doctors to take rest and do rehabilitation for six months. “I am doing light training and hopefully will recover within the stipulated period,” Inayat said.

He sustained the injury while training for the Peshawar National Games last year where he won gold while playing with the injury. Later he won gold in the 13th South Asian Games in Nepal.

“I wanted to add to my feathers and did not even let my father know exactly about the injury,” Inayat said. “I had in mind a seat in the 2020 Tokyo Olympics but when I got injured I felt it was not possible. Now that the Olympics have been delayed I am looking forward to trying my luck in the qualifiers after recovering from the injury,” said Inayat, an exceptionally talented grappler.

Inayat was trained for around 12 years at Peshawar by Mohammad Naeem, an international wrestler of Afghanistan. Inayat says that with support from fans and the government he can achieve the big the target of the Olympic medal.

Inayat said that he can achieve big targets if he is supported. “Naeem worked hard with me to help me achieve what he could not achieve as a wrestler because of a bullet injury,” said Inayat, who has around 35 players training under him at his academy. “I am a coach too, training around 35 wrestlers in Peshawar,” he said.
